
Prep Time 15 minutes mins
Cook Time 4 hours hrs
Servings: 25 , 1.5′ x 1.5′ squares
Ingredients
For the Fudge
- 1 cup 2 sticks unsalted butter
- 1 cup light brown sugar
- ½ cup granulated sugar
- ⅔ cup evaporated milk
- 1 cup marshmallow creme
- ¾ cup creamy peanut butter
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- ½ teaspoon salt
For the Topping
- ⅓ cup dark chocolate chips
- ½ cup crushed hard pretzel pieces
- ⅓ cup roasted peanuts
- chocolate syrup for drizzle
Directions
- Prepare the baking pan. Line an 8-inch square baking pan with parchment paper, leaving an overhang on two sides for easy removal.
- Make the fudge base. In a medium saucepan, combine the butter, brown sugar, granulated sugar, and evaporated milk. Cook over medium heat, stirring frequently, until the mixture comes to a full rolling boil. Continue boiling for 4 to 5 minutes, stirring constantly and scraping down the sides of the pan with a spatula to prevent burning.
- Add the remaining ingredients. Remove the saucepan from the heat. Immediately stir in the marshmallow creme, peanut butter, vanilla extract, and kosher salt until the mixture is smooth and free of bubbles.
- Pour the fudge and add the toppings. Pour the fudge into the prepared pan and smooth the surface with a spatula. Drizzle the chocolate syrup over the top in a zigzag pattern, extending it to the edges of the pan. Evenly sprinkle the dark chocolate chips, crushed pretzels, and roasted peanuts over the top, gently pressing them into the fudge so they adhere as it sets.
- Chill and serve. Refrigerate the fudge for at least 4 hours, or overnight, until firm. Using the parchment overhang, lift the fudge out of the pan and cut it into even squares before serving.

This Peanut Butter Fudge Overload recipe is made in honor of Geo’s father, whose legendary sweet treats were loved by their family. It is a perfectly sweet brown sugar peanut butter fudge loaded with pretzels, dark chocolate chips, peanuts, and a decadent chocolate drizzle.
